Electronic timing in SMARTSENSE™ will advance timing automatically for peak performance during all driving conditions. This sacrifices performance and efficiency during the other driving phases. Using mechanical timing adjustments alone, you can only target one driving condition, such as higher start power or higher top end speed. When running, a motor must transition between different load points and a different timing advance is required for optimal efficiency at all load points. Once the motor is turning, it seamlessly transitions to Castle’s ULTRA- EFFICIENT sensorless mode. SMARTSENSE™ uses the motors sensors to start the motor to provide smooth starts, excellent torque, and low-speed drivability. Please refer to this document for running and maintaining motors in wet environments. Routine maintenance is recommended after running in wet conditions. Castle recommends applying dielectric grease to the outside of the sensor wire connections after installation of the wire. The sensor connections are not water resistant water can cause signal loss which could result in loss of sensored capabilities. Water Resistant Design: The sensor board is coated with silicone conformal coating to protect the sensors from moisture. Running modes: SmartSense™ Sensored and an ultra-efficient Sensorless mode. Due to the high power nature of this motor it is highly recommended to use a 1/8th scale size ESC or larger. It uses a 5mm output shaft, 12AWG wires and 6.5mm bullets. We beefed up the design over a standard 14xx series motor to handle the high demands of drag racing. Your final drive ratio will need to be decreased (larger pinion/smaller spur) to get the RPMs up for top speed due to the size of the motor it will take just about any gearing and CHEAT timing you can throw at it. This results in a high horsepower, snappy, cool running motor. The 1412 is longer than most drag motors, which provides significantly more torque, acceleration, and cooler temps (think American Muscle) but still in a 540 diameter motor so it fits most vehicles. These motors rely on high RPM and low torque to push the car down the track (think turbo charged 4 cylinder). Most no prep motors are standard 540 size with very high kv (low turn). We went with a slightly different approach than current motors on the market. ![]() The 1412-6400kv motor is a very high torque, high wattage, mid-RPM motor designed for 2s no prep Street Eliminator racing.
